Juan Atkins, Kode9, L-Vis 1990, Julio Bashmore, many more sign up
for MoMA PS1 Warm Up series
May 23, 2013 11:03am | Fact Magazine The Long Island City museum announces its eagerly-anticipated summer concert series. For its 16th year, the Saturday series begins June 29 and ends on September 7. As always, the concerts take place in the MoMA PS1 courtyard, which will feature an “urban landscape” by CODA called Party Wall, the winner of the 14th annual Young Architects Program. Check Out The Official Daft Punk Racecar
May 23, 2013 10:51am | StereoGum Daft Punk’s masterful new album Random Access Memories takes its time in getting anywhere, but this hasn’t stopped the French duo from getting their own formula one racecar. Columbia, the duo’s label, is a partner with Team Lotus F1, the British racing team, and a new YouTube video shows the robots walking toward a formula one car that appears to bear their logo. Hard to say from all this, but it appears that the Daft Punk racecar is racing in the Grand Prix De Monaco, an annual race that starts today. Watch the short and cryptic video below. Read More...
Watch the first short film by Scottish artist Konx-om-Pax, Under
The Bridge
May 23, 2013 10:50am | Fact Magazine Under The Bridge" title="Watch the first short film by Scottish artist Konx-om-Pax, Under The Bridge" width="685" height="371"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-155817" /> The Glaswegian multimedia artist shares his first short film. Konx-om-Pax is the alias of Tom Scholefield, an artist who has released music on Planet Mu (last year’s Regional Surrealism) and has helped define the visual aesthetic of Hyperdub, Brainfeeder and LuckyMe with his design work. Scholefield wore all the hats in the creation of Under The Bridge, a short film that he directed, animated, edited, and sound designed. Two young men encounter (and flee) an incandescent construct of skulls, reminiscent of the neon-coated, deep space creature that he animated for Lone’s Galaxy Garden trailer. Quadron (mem. of Rhye) releasing new LP (stream a track w/ Kendrick
Lamar), opening for Junip and Lianne La Havas
May 23, 2013 10:50am | Brooklyn Vegan by Andrew Sacher DOWNLOAD: Black Hippy - "U.O.E.N.O" Remix (MP3) When we first realized Rhye wasn't as mysterious as we thought, it was brought into the public consciousness that one half of the duo was Mike Milosh (better known as just Milosh) and Robin Hannibal, who is also one half of the duo Quadron with Coco O. Quadron is set to release a new album, Avalanche, on June 4 via Vested in Culture/Epic, and in very exciting news, the first single, "Better Off," features a verse from Kendrick Lamar. Pitchfork mentions that Robin and Coco were also in a group called Boom Clap Bachelors, whose song "Tiden Flyver" is prominently sampled in Kendrick's "Bitch, Don't Kill My Vibe." Check out "Better Off" below, along with the album tracklist. That's the artwork above. Quadron also have some tour dates coming up around the time of the album's release. They'll be a support act for some of the dates on Jose Gonzalez's group Junip's previously discussed tour, including the NYC date happening on June 13 at Highline Ballroom. Barbarossa is on that show too, which is sold out. Quadron will also return to NYC for a free, all ages show opening for UK singer Lianne La Havas at Central Park Summerstage on July 27. Detroit legend Marcellus Pittman to play Make Me loft party in
London
May 23, 2013 10:38am | Fact Magazine A slice of Detroit arrives in London on Saturday May 25. Well this is just a bit exciting, London’s Make Me have scored a rare appearance from Detroit house legend Marcellus Pittman. Known for his slew of releases on Theo Parrish‘s Sound Signature and Omar-S‘s FXHE, Pittman is also a member of the spine-chillingly important 3 Chairs alongside Parrish, Moodyman, and The Rotating Assembly’s Rick Wilhite. Support will be coming from Make Me residents Rubin, Rupe and Nic Baird. Gucci Mane embraces Bandcamp for new album Trap House III; stream
it now
May 23, 2013 10:17am | Fact Magazine Trap back. Bandcamp might have a reputation as something of an indie outpost, but it seems like even slightly crazed Atlanta rappers see the business model as being workable. Gucci Mane‘s latest album Trap House III (billed as Gucci’s final ‘trap’ record) was just released via the digital distribution network, and while the rapper is no stranger to putting music online (we’ve had countless mixtapes this year already) it’s the first time a ‘proper’ album of his has made its debut online. Weirdly the album still isn’t available on iTunes, and Gucci himself Tweeted that “It must be a conspiracy”. Disclosure working w/ Nile Rodgers (who's also working with...
Avicii and David Guetta?), remixed by Baauer (listen)
May 23, 2013 10:12am | Brooklyn Vegan by Andrew Sacher Disclosure at MHOW in March (more by Jason
Bergman) Fresh off of working on the killer new Daft Punk album, disco legend/Chic founder Nile Rodgers revealed at the International Music Summit that they aren't the only modern electronic musicians that he's working with. FACT reports that he'll be working with hot new UK garage duo Disclosure, in addition to... big EDM names Avicii (who's also working with another RAM collaborator/disco legend Giorgio Moroder) and David Guetta. Nile also mentioned collaborations with Chase & Status and Etienne Daho. As mentioned, Disclosure are set to release their much-anticipated debut album, Settle, on June 3 via PMR. Its most recently released single, "You & Me" (which features vocals from Eliza Doolittle), was just given remix treatment by Baauer, who is no stranger to Disclosure's material.
